Chevy Chase had meltdown on Community set after slur leak

A witness recalls Chevy Chase suffering a full meltdown on the set of Community following the leak of an N-word incident. The actor reportedly lamented that his career was ruined in the aftermath. This revelation comes from a detailed account in People magazine.

Marina Zenovich's new documentary, 'I'm Chevy Chase and You're Not,' delves into the comedian's groundbreaking career alongside his notorious personal flaws. The film traces Chase's rise from Saturday Night Live to Hollywood stardom while confronting tales of his on-set cruelty and off-screen behavior. Through interviews and archival footage, it explores how his troubled childhood shaped a complex figure adored by fans yet reviled by colleagues.

In 2004, NBC produced six episodes of the sitcom 'The Men's Room' featuring John Cho but never aired them due to dissatisfaction with the creative direction. The show, centered on three friends at life's crossroads, was halted before release. Cho's career later flourished through other projects like the 'Star Trek' films.
